Alejandro Garnacho Picks the Stamford Bridge Club as His Next Stop

Manchester United winger Alejandro Garnacho is believed to have confirmed his future. As per The Sun, he is ready to join Chelsea in the summer transfer window. The 20-year-old Argentine looked phenomenal under Erik ten Hag. He has produced some serious numbers this season with 21 goal contributions.

Garnacho has been at odds with new boss Ruben Amorim in the recent weeks. That is especially after being named as a substitute for the Europa League final loss against Spurs. All this has pushed Garnacho toward the exit. He is not happy by the lack of trust in big matches. Now, the young winger has made it clear to his camp about his future. As per reports, he wants to join the Blues.

Although, Red Devils had hoped to sell their player to a club abroad. But, an interest from Chelsea has turned his head. Amorim’s side have responded by slapping a £60 million price tag on his name.

Meanwhile, the move has left a bitter taste for former manager Ten Hag. The former Utd manager had hoped to bring him to Bayer Leverkusen. Now, other suitors like Napoli and Atletico Madrid, his old youth club, are likely to miss out.

Mixed Reactions at United Over the Winger’s Decision

Garnacho’s likely move to a Premier League rival has stirred strong reactions. While Utd legend Roy Keane believes the player should leave due to maturity concerns. And Paul Scholes has expressed disappointment, warning that his former side could regret letting him and youngster Kobbie Mainoo leave.

Despite his age, the forward has become a key attacking option for Utd. And losing him to a domestic rival could likely backfire in the future.

Meanwhile, Utd’s new owners INEOS seem set on reshaping the squad and using Garnacho’s sale to boost their transfer budget. Still, letting go of a young, talented winger who has already proven himself in big games may not sit well with many fans.

If Chelsea do seal the deal, they’ll be adding a hungry and explosive wide man to their ranks. He is the one who might just have a point to prove back at Old Trafford.
